| パッケージ | 説明 | 
|---|---|
| java.awt.image | イメージを作成および修正するためのクラスを提供します。 | 
| javax.imageio | Java Image I/O API の基本パッケージです。 | 
| 修飾子と型 | クラスと説明 | 
|---|---|
| class  | BandedSampleModelこのクラスは、バンドインタリーブ化方式で格納されるイメージデータを表します。ピクセルの各サンプルは、DataBuffer のデータ要素に 1 つずつ格納されます。 | 
| class  | ComponentSampleModelこのクラスは、DataBuffer のデータ要素 1 つに 1 つずつピクセルを形成する各サンプルが格納されているイメージデータを表します。 | 
| class  | MultiPixelPackedSampleModelMultiPixelPackedSampleModelクラスは、単一バンド化されたイメージを表現し、複数の単一サンプルピクセルを 1 つのデータ要素にパックできます。 | 
| class  | PixelInterleavedSampleModelこのクラスは、ピクセルインタリーブ化方式で格納され、ピクセルの各サンプルが DataBuffer の 1 データ要素を占めるイメージデータを表します。 | 
| class  | SinglePixelPackedSampleModelこのクラスは、1 つのピクセルを構成する N 個のサンプルが 1 つのデータ配列要素に格納されるようにパックされたピクセルデータを表します。データ配列要素の各データは 1 つのピクセルだけのサンプルを保持します。 | 
| 修飾子と型 | フィールドと説明 | 
|---|---|
| protected SampleModel | Raster. sampleModelこの Raster のピクセルが DataBuffer に格納される方法を記述する SampleModel です。 | 
| 修飾子と型 | メソッドと説明 | 
|---|---|
| SampleModel | IndexColorModel. createCompatibleSampleModel(int w,                            int h)この  ColorModelと互換性のあるデータレイアウトを持つ、指定された幅と高さのSampleModelを作成します。 | 
| SampleModel | PackedColorModel. createCompatibleSampleModel(int w,                            int h)この  ColorModelと互換性のあるデータレイアウトを持つ、指定された幅と高さのSampleModelを作成します。 | 
| abstract SampleModel | SampleModel. createCompatibleSampleModel(int w,                            int h)この SampleModel の形式でデータが記述されている、幅と高さが異なる SampleModel を生成します。 | 
| SampleModel | PixelInterleavedSampleModel. createCompatibleSampleModel(int w,                            int h)指定された幅と高さを持つ新しい PixelInterleavedSampleModel を生成します。 | 
| SampleModel | BandedSampleModel. createCompatibleSampleModel(int w,                            int h)指定された幅と高さを持つ新しい BandedSampleModel を作成します。 | 
| SampleModel | SinglePixelPackedSampleModel. createCompatibleSampleModel(int w,                            int h)指定された幅と高さを使って新しい SinglePixelPackedSampleModel を作成します。 | 
| SampleModel | ComponentColorModel. createCompatibleSampleModel(int w,                            int h)この  ColorModelと互換性のあるデータレイアウトを持つ、指定された幅と高さのSampleModelを作成します。 | 
| SampleModel | MultiPixelPackedSampleModel. createCompatibleSampleModel(int w,                            int h)指定された幅と高さを持つ新しい  MultiPixelPackedSampleModelを作成します。 | 
| SampleModel | ColorModel. createCompatibleSampleModel(int w,                            int h)この  ColorModelと互換性のあるデータレイアウトを持つ、指定された幅と高さのSampleModelを作成します。 | 
| SampleModel | ComponentSampleModel. createCompatibleSampleModel(int w,                            int h)指定された幅と高さを持つ新しい  ComponentSampleModelを作成します。 | 
| abstract SampleModel | SampleModel. createSubsetSampleModel(int[] bands)この SampleModel のバンドのサブセットを使って新しい SampleModel を生成します。 | 
| SampleModel | PixelInterleavedSampleModel. createSubsetSampleModel(int[] bands)この PixelInterleavedSampleModel のバンドのサブセットを持つ新しい PixelInterleavedSampleModel を生成します。 | 
| SampleModel | BandedSampleModel. createSubsetSampleModel(int[] bands)この BandedSampleModel のバンドのサブセットを持つ新しい BandedSampleModel を作成します。 | 
| SampleModel | SinglePixelPackedSampleModel. createSubsetSampleModel(int[] bands)この SinglePixelPackedSampleModel のバンドのサブセットを使って新しい SinglePixelPackedSampleModel を作成します。 | 
| SampleModel | MultiPixelPackedSampleModel. createSubsetSampleModel(int[] bands)この  MultiPixelPackedSampleModelのバンドのサブセットを持つ新しいMultiPixelPackedSampleModelを生成します。 | 
| SampleModel | ComponentSampleModel. createSubsetSampleModel(int[] bands)この ComponentSampleModel のサブセットを持つ、新しい ComponentSampleModel を構築します。 | 
| SampleModel | BufferedImage. getSampleModel()この  BufferedImageに関連付けられたSampleModelを返します。 | 
| SampleModel | Raster. getSampleModel()イメージデータのレイアウトを記述する SampleModel を返します。 | 
| SampleModel | RenderedImage. getSampleModel()このイメージに関連した SampleModel を返します。 | 
| 修飾子と型 | メソッドと説明 | 
|---|---|
| static Raster | Raster. createRaster(SampleModel sm,             DataBuffer db,             Point location)指定された SampleModel と DataBuffer を持つ Raster を生成します。 | 
| static WritableRaster | Raster. createWritableRaster(SampleModel sm,                     DataBuffer db,                     Point location)指定された SampleModel と DataBuffer を持つ WritableRaster を生成します。 | 
| static WritableRaster | Raster. createWritableRaster(SampleModel sm,                     Point location)指定された SampleModel を持つ WritableRaster を生成します。 | 
| boolean | IndexColorModel. isCompatibleSampleModel(SampleModel sm)指定された  SampleModelがこのColorModelと互換性があるかどうかを調べます。 | 
| boolean | PackedColorModel. isCompatibleSampleModel(SampleModel sm)指定された  SampleModelがこのColorModelと互換性があるかどうかを調べます。 | 
| boolean | ComponentColorModel. isCompatibleSampleModel(SampleModel sm)指定された  SampleModelがこのColorModelと互換性があるかどうかを判定します。 | 
| boolean | ColorModel. isCompatibleSampleModel(SampleModel sm)SampleModelがこのColorModelと互換性があるかどうかを判定します。 | 
| コンストラクタと説明 | 
|---|
| Raster(SampleModel sampleModel,       DataBuffer dataBuffer,       Point origin)指定された SampleModel および DataBuffer を持つ Raster を構築します。 | 
| Raster(SampleModel sampleModel,       DataBuffer dataBuffer,       Rectangle aRegion,       Point sampleModelTranslate,       Raster parent)指定された SampleModel、DataBuffer、および親を使って Raster を構築します。 | 
| Raster(SampleModel sampleModel,       Point origin)指定された SampleModel を持つ Raster を構築します。 | 
| WritableRaster(SampleModel sampleModel,               DataBuffer dataBuffer,               Point origin)指定された SampleModel および DataBuffer を持つ WritableRaster を構築します。 | 
| WritableRaster(SampleModel sampleModel,               DataBuffer dataBuffer,               Rectangle aRegion,               Point sampleModelTranslate,               WritableRaster parent)指定された SampleModel、DataBuffer、および親を使って WritableRaster を構築します。 | 
| WritableRaster(SampleModel sampleModel,               Point origin)指定された SampleModel を持つ WritableRaster を構築します。 | 
| 修飾子と型 | フィールドと説明 | 
|---|---|
| protected SampleModel | ImageTypeSpecifier. sampleModelプロトタイプとして使用する  SampleModelです。 | 
| 修飾子と型 | メソッドと説明 | 
|---|---|
| SampleModel | ImageTypeSpecifier. getSampleModel()このオブジェクト内にカプセル化された設定に基づく  SampleModelを返します。 | 
| SampleModel | ImageTypeSpecifier. getSampleModel(int width,               int height)このオブジェクト内にカプセル化された設定に基づく  SampleModelを返します。 | 
| コンストラクタと説明 | 
|---|
| ImageTypeSpecifier(ColorModel colorModel,                   SampleModel sampleModel)ColorModelとSampleModelから直接ImageTypeSpecifierを構築します。 | 
 バグまたは機能を送信 
詳細な API リファレンスおよび開発者ドキュメントについては、Java SE のドキュメントを参照してください。そのドキュメントには、概念的な概要、用語の定義、回避方法、有効なコード例などの、開発者を対象にしたより詳細な説明が含まれています。
Copyright © 1993, 2013, Oracle and/or its affiliates. All rights reserved.